Index: content/test/data/accessibility/modal-dialog-closed.html |
diff --git a/content/test/data/accessibility/modal-dialog-closed.html b/content/test/data/accessibility/modal-dialog-closed.html |
new file mode 100644 |
index 0000000000000000000000000000000000000000..866014ca66aaa7c6ab2106fd9ea868fdc3ac279d |
--- /dev/null |
+++ b/content/test/data/accessibility/modal-dialog-closed.html |
@@ -0,0 +1,23 @@ |
+<!-- |
+@MAC-ALLOW:AXSubrole=* |
+--> |
+<html> |
+<body> |
+Test that elements respawn in the accessibility tree after a modal dialog |
+closes. |
+<section> |
+ <dialog>This dialog is closed and should not be in the tree</dialog> |
+ <select> |
+ <optgroup label="Group"> |
+ <option>This should be in the tree.</option> |
+ </optgroup> |
+ </select> |
+</section> |
+<input type=color> |
+<script> |
+var dialog = document.querySelector('dialog'); |
+dialog.showModal(); |
+dialog.close(); |
+</script> |
+</body> |
+</html> |